One of the key ways to protect your wealth is to be mindful of the fees associated with financial advice. While it's important to pay for quality advice, excessive fees can eat away at your wealth over time. This is where a financial guardian can help by providing transparent fee structures and helping you to understand where your money is going.
When seeking out a financial advisor, it's important to ask about their fee structure and make sure it aligns with your financial goals. Some advisors may charge a flat fee for their services, while others may work on a commission basis. It's important to understand how your advisor is being compensated and to ensure that their interests are aligned with yours.
Additionally, a financial guardian can help you to reduce fees by recommending low cost investment options such as index funds or exchange traded funds (ETFs). These investment vehicles typically have lower fees than actively managed funds, allowing you to keep more of your returns over time.
